Back-table arterial reconstructions in liver transplantation: single-center experience

Summary
Hepatic artery variations (HAV) in liver grafts occur in 21.4% of cases, often requiring complex reconstructions. While reconstructions slightly increase thrombosis risk, survival rates remain comparable to grafts without variations.

Background:
- Anatomic variations in donor liver graft arterial supply necessitate complex hepatic artery reconstructions.
- These reconstructions increase the risk of arterial thrombosis and graft loss due to additional anastomoses.
Purpose of the Study:
- To review the incidence and types of hepatic artery variations (HAV) in liver grafts.
- To analyze the types of hepatic artery reconstructions performed.
- To evaluate the impact of HAV and reconstructions on graft and patient survival rates after orthotopic liver transplantation (OLT).
Main Methods:
- Retrospective review of 620 orthotopic liver transplantations (OLT) from June 1983 to August 2004.
- Analysis of donor hepatic artery variations (HAV) and surgical reconstruction techniques.
- Assessment of 1- and 5-year graft and patient survival rates.
Main Results:
- Hepatic artery variations (HAV) were present in 133 liver grafts (21.4%).
- The most common variation was the right hepatic artery (RHA) originating from the superior mesenteric artery (SMA).
- Of 133 grafts with HAV, 56 (42%) required arterial reconstruction, with termino-terminal (TT) anastomosis between RHA and splenic artery being most frequent.
- Hepatic artery thrombosis occurred in 5.4% of complex reconstructions versus 2.2% in other grafts.
- One- and 5-year survival rates were 73.2%/71.4% with reconstructions and 78.6%/76.8% without.
Conclusions:
- Hepatic artery variations are common in liver grafts and often require surgical reconstruction.
- While complex reconstructions are associated with a slightly higher rate of hepatic artery thrombosis, they do not significantly compromise long-term graft or patient survival.
- Careful surgical planning and execution of reconstructions are crucial for successful liver transplantation in the presence of arterial variations.
